Composition and Structure of Military Bands

Military bands typically comprise a variety of musical ensembles structured to fulfill specific ceremonial and entertainment roles. They usually include brass, woodwind, percussion, and sometimes string instruments, each contributing to the band’s overall sound. This diverse composition ensures versatility across various performances and functions.

The core of these bands often features a brass section, including trumpets, trombones, euphoniums, and tubas, providing powerful, melodic support. Woodwind instruments such as clarinets, flutes, and saxophones add tonal richness and flexibility. Percussion sections, with drums, cymbals, and timpani, underpin the rhythm and emphasize ceremonial moments.

The structure of a military band typically includes a bandleader or drum major, responsible for leadership and coordination. Subsections like concert bands, marching bands, and specialized ensembles operate within the broader organization, enabling tailored performances. This structured composition allows military bands to adapt seamlessly to diverse roles, from formal ceremonies to entertainment.

The United States Military Bands

The United States Military Bands represent the oldest and most extensive musical organization within the U.S. armed forces. Comprising over 50 bands and ensembles, they serve both ceremonial and entertainment purposes across the country and internationally.

These bands perform at a variety of occasions, including national celebrations, diplomatic events, and military ceremonies, fostering patriotism and reinforcing military tradition. They also participate frequently in public outreach and community engagement activities.

Key roles of the United States Military Bands include providing musical support during official functions and boosting morale among service members. Their performances often feature a diverse repertoire, including classical, popular, and patriotic music, showcasing versatility and professionalism.

Some notable examples include the United States Army Band, the Navy Band, and the Air Force Band, each with unique traditions and specialized functions. Their contributions significantly influence the broader landscape of military entertainment and cultural diplomacy.
